She took us to a great local deli to grab a picnic of
Hawaiian foods: Huli Huli chicken, ahi tuna poke, pork, octopus, and malasadas.
We also had the purple sweet potatoes - ube. Malasadas are Portuguese donuts.
Ours were made from turo.

Breakfast was again in the Horizon Court buffet where they had another Filipino favorite: Beef Tapas!! This is marinated beef with spices. Also delicious over fried rice with an egg. For yesterday's sea day, we had an early breakfast in Horizon Court which is the ship's buffet. As with most Princess ships, they had some Filipino items including Pork Tocino. This is pork that has been marinated with vinegar and spices. The texture is almost like the boneless spareribs served at some Asian restaurants - but usually with a bit more flavor and bite from the vinegar. These weren't the best version I have ever had. They need a bit more vinegar flavor. But it was a very good breakfast, especially over garlic fried rice with fried eggs on top.
